In the 33rd ODI of ICC World Cup 2019, Pakistan loses second wicket on 44 runs against New Zealand at Edgbaston.

According to the reports of Baaghitv, chasing a target of 238, Pakistan loses opener Imam-Ul-Haq on total score of 44. Imam-Ul-Haq scored 19 runs of 29 balls. Fakhar Zaman is the batsman who got out by scoring 9 runs.
